On the Wee Witness website it also states how they have a new line at Family Christian stores and they offer bottles, pacifiers and even the clothes/ blankets/ bibs have images of babies with bottles and pacifiers too. This is my big thing for women of faith who then in turn do not breastfeed (and not because of a problem) or only breastfeed a few weeks. They just don't see the importance or connection. I am always trying to get the message out to women of faith (even no matter Christian, Jew or Muslim etc) that God made breasts for breastfeeding and (will say to Christians Jesus was breastfed!) And how when we who say we believe in God and trust Him and then we choose a man made way to feed our baby it says something and it also shows that we are not good sterwards of what God has given us-using money to buy formula instead of using free breastmilk that also saves money in so many other ways. I tell them how breastfeeding is in the Bible ( they are always surprised by that and my favorite verse in my sig. line) and the Bible talks about much more than it being just for feeding but about comfort and trust! Because I see so many just feeding breastmilk, though from the breast, but it is only about feeding to them.
